Branka Stevanović is a scholar working on Plant Science, Ecology, Evolution, Behavior and Systematics and Molecular Biology. According to data from OpenAlex, Branka Stevanović has authored 59 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 46 papers in Plant Science, 27 papers in Ecology, Evolution, Behavior and Systematics and 16 papers in Molecular Biology. Recurrent topics in Branka Stevanović's work include Botany and Plant Ecology Studies (15 papers), Plant Diversity and Evolution (11 papers) and Plant Stress Responses and Tolerance (9 papers). Branka Stevanović is often cited by papers focused on Botany and Plant Ecology Studies (15 papers), Plant Diversity and Evolution (11 papers) and Plant Stress Responses and Tolerance (9 papers). Branka Stevanović collaborates with scholars based in Serbia, Czechia and Azerbaijan. Branka Stevanović's co-authors include F. Navari‐Izzo, Cristina Sgherri, Vladimir D. Stevanović, Zorka Vukmirović, M. Tasič, S. Rajšić, Milica Tomašević, Tamara Rakić, Gordana Gajić and Olga Kostić and has published in prestigious journ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Chemosphere.
